Fowler 542255050 Auto Tread Plus

Part Number: FOW542255050

Need Assistance or Service? Please call 262-251-4020

Manufacturer: FOWLER
SKU: 1523951
$36.30
Auto Tread PLUS
Products specifications
Attribute name Attribute value
Shipping State MASSACHUSETTS
Made In USA NO
Only registered users can write reviews